Comparison Results
| Metric | $34,675 | $94,675 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| $34,675 | $94,675 | $60,000 |
| Federal Tax | $2,123 | $12,443 | $10,320 |
| State Tax | $0 | $0 | $0 |
| FICA (SS + Medicare) | $2,653 | $7,243 | $4,590 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| $29,900 | $74,990 | $45,090 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| $2,492 | $6,249 | $3,758 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 13.8% | 20.8% | 7.0% |

Tax Bracket Change: This salary increase crosses from the 12% Bracket into the 22% Bracket. Only the income above the threshold is taxed at the higher rate - you won't lose money by earning more.
State Tax Varies: These calculations use Texas (0% state tax). In California, you'd pay an additional ~6-9% state tax. In New York, add ~5-8%. Florida, Texas, Washington, and Nevada have no state income tax.
